Hotels near Curious Clocks of London in London
Find the best hotel for you near Curious Clocks of London based on location, price or preference
Compare Curious Clocks of London hotel deals across hundreds of providers, all in one place
Look out for Curious Clocks of London hotels with free cancellation or excellent ratings